#282 - Upload con ASP.NET

Il primo script ASP.NET è quello più richiesto in versione ASP: l'upload di file da una pagina web.
Basta essenzialmente una riga di codice, per fare quello che uno script ASP classico fa in una decina, come minimo.

<SCRIPT language="VB" RUNAT="server">

Sub BtnUp_Click(sender As Object, e As EventArgs)

  inputFile.PostedFile.SaveAs( Server.MapPath(inputNome.Value) )
  Results.InnerHTML = "FileUploadato su " & inputNome.Value & "</b>!"

End Sub

</SCRIPT>
<form enctype="multipart/form-data" RUNAT="server">
<DIV id=Results RUNAT="server"></DIV>

Upload di questo file: <input id="inputFile" type=file RUNAT="server"><br>

Nome: <input id="inputNome" type="text" RUNAT="server"><br>
<input type=button id="BtnUp" value="Upload!"
OnServerClick="BtnUp_Click" RUNAT="server">
</form>

Con questo primo esempio vengono già usate diverse delle nuove caratteristiche di ASP.NET (beta 2 in questo caso), come i web controls, totalmente programmabili, come oggetti DHTML tradizionali, con eventi e proprietà modificabili a runtime.
Avremo modo di tornare molto presto su ASP.NET, nel corso dei prossimo script.

Per una introduzione alla beta 2 si veda
http://www.aspitalia.com/articoli/aspplus/beta2.asp


Approfondimenti

Commenti

Esprimi il tuo giudizio su questo script:

Per procedere devi essere autenticato.

Scream scrive:
#282 - Upload con ASP.NET

Dovrei generare X campi in base al valore X inserito in un database.Se per esempio nel database il valore è 4 devo creare 4 campi di upload.Al momento...
martedì 13 settembre 2005 | 1 risposta
valer80 scrive:
#282 - Upload con ASP.NET

ma è possibile fare upload multipli di file selezionando da un unico tasto SFOGLIA ?oppure di cartelle?Grazie
giovedì 7 luglio 2005 | 1 risposta
luKam scrive:
#282 - Upload con ASP.NET

Ho problemi nell'upload di file da Mac. I file risultano corrotti.Mi è sembrato di capire che ASP.NET non supporta l'upload di file in formato ...
mercoledì 21 aprile 2004 | 2 risposte
cesarino in #282 - Upload con ASP.NET
venerdì 5 marzo 2004 | 1 risposta
goku68it in Upload con ASP.NET
martedì 13 novembre 2001 | 3 risposte
fabiocit in #282 - Upload con ASP.NET
lunedì 25 febbraio 2002 | 1 risposta
algagna in Upload con ASP.NET
domenica 12 agosto 2001 | 2 risposte

Aggiungi un nuovo commento »»»
Per inserire un commento, devi registrarti alla nostra community.




IN EVIDENZA
MISC